Sawaddee Ka!

Earlier in my career I sometimes found myself struggling between whether I should share the “traditional” version of a dish, or a modification that I prefer. I felt the responsibility of being a good “ambassador” of Thai cuisine; but on the other hand I also believed “more delicious is better”!

As I’ve grown in confidence, I’m more comfortable making changes because I realize that no dish is static. Most dishes didn’t start out exactly as they are now. ALL cuisines evolve, and everyone has a right to participate in that evolution…hopefully for the better. For more “deliciousness”.

The latest recipe is a drastic modification, and one that would go very well with leftover turkey!

There’s a pasta dish in Thailand called “dried chilies spaghetti” that SOUNDED good given the ingredients…but to me always failed to deliver. So I decided to take those ingredients and rework them into something incredible. You can read more about the original dish and how I changed it in the blog post.

A Patreon member said that this would go very well with his leftover Thanksgiving turkey, and he is absolutely right! I’ve had it with mackerel, sausages, and chicken; all were fantastic.
